发布时间2025-06-19 18:12
在当今数字化时代,随着人工智能和机器学习技术的飞速发展,语音识别翻译成为了一个热门的研究领域。它不仅能够实现实时的语音到文本转换,还能够将文本翻译成另一种语言,为人们提供了更加便捷、高效的沟通方式。然而,要开发一个高质量的聊天功能语音识别翻译系统,需要经过多方面的努力和创新。本文将介绍如何开发这样一个系统,包括技术选型、系统架构设计、关键技术实现以及测试与优化等方面的知识。
首先,确定技术选型是开发聊天功能语音识别翻译系统的第一步。目前市场上存在多种语音识别技术和翻译算法,如深度学习模型(如循环神经网络RNN、长短时记忆网络LSTM等)、基于规则的翻译方法、以及基于统计的机器翻译等。开发者需要根据自己的需求和资源选择合适的技术方案。例如,如果目标是快速响应且对准确性要求不高的场景,可以选择基于规则的方法;如果追求高精度和流畅性,则可以考虑使用深度学习模型。
接下来,系统架构设计是确保系统稳定性和可扩展性的关键。一个好的系统架构应该具备模块化、可复用、易于维护等特点。对于语音识别翻译系统,常见的架构包括前端处理层、语音识别模块、自然语言处理模块、翻译模块和后端服务器等部分。其中,语音识别模块负责将用户的语音输入转换为文本数据;自然语言处理模块负责对文本数据进行分词、词性标注、语义理解等操作;翻译模块则是将处理后的文本数据翻译成目标语言;后端服务器则负责存储和管理数据,提供API接口供前端调用。
在关键技术实现方面,开发者需要关注语音识别的准确性、翻译的流畅性和系统的响应速度。为了提高语音识别的准确性,可以使用深度学习模型进行特征提取和分类器训练;为了优化翻译的流畅性,可以研究不同语言之间的语法和语义差异,并采用适当的翻译策略;同时,还需要关注系统的响应速度,以确保用户能够及时得到反馈。
最后,测试与优化是确保系统质量的重要环节。在开发过程中,开发者需要不断进行单元测试、集成测试和系统测试,以发现并修复各种问题。此外,还需要根据用户反馈和实际运行情况对系统进行持续优化,以提高性能和用户体验。
总之,开发一个聊天功能语音识别翻译系统是一个复杂的过程,需要综合考虑技术选型、系统架构设计、关键技术实现以及测试与优化等多个方面。通过不断学习和探索新技术和方法,开发者可以逐步提高自己的技术水平,开发出更加优秀的产品。
猜你喜欢:环信超级社区
更多厂商资讯